Cost of acquiring a new key

There are many factors that affect the price of a new car key. It is all dependent on the brand of the car, the technology, and the model of the vehicle. It also depends on the place you park your car.

Going to a dealer will generally result in savings. Many dealerships offer special discounts which will reduce the cost of key replacement. You may be eligible for towing services that are free. This is particularly the case for luxury vehicles.

A few dealerships allow you to program a key fob in your vehicle, which can save you a significant amount of money. This process can take a while so be aware. Some dealers will charge an additional fee to program your key.

Another way you can save money on your next key replacement is to purchase aftermarket keys. These keys are manufactured by several companies. These keys are typically less expensive than the origination process, which requires the creation of an entirely new key.

The cost of acquiring a new key also depends on where you live. If you are nearer to the dealership, the price can be much lower. However in the event that you have to drive a distance for the trip, the cost could be higher.

Finally, you should examine your insurance coverage. The majority of insurance companies will provide details about the cost of purchasing a new key for your car as well as the kind of key. You can then go through your policy and request reimbursement for the cost.

Finding a new car key for your car can be stressful. To ensure that you're covered, be sure to verify your insurance coverage. Make sure to check your warranty and extended coverage, too.

A new car key is an essential component of owning a car. You should never let a key go missing and should have two or more keys on hand. If you lose your key, you can contact your local locksmith or dealership. They can unlock your vehicle and program your keys.

Can a locksmith duplicate the key portion of the key fob?

If you've lost your keys a locksmith is a great alternative to purchase a new set. They can also reprogram your keys and even replace them if you need to.

Locksmiths have the knowledge and equipment to duplicate most keys. There are however some keys that are more difficult to duplicate. Keys with high security include keys and restricted keys.

Restricted keys are typically made by a particular manufacturer. To copy the key, you'll require permission from the car manufacturer. You'll need to present proof of ownership to the company in order to do this.

Keys with high security are more difficult to duplicate. A professional locksmith may have to make use of a special machine or cut the key by hand. They might also charge you more.

Modern car keys have transponder chips, which are electronic components that work with your vehicle. These chips are designed to safeguard your car from theft and damage. Keys are used as standard equipment in the majority of cars. You can obtain duplicates at your local hardware store or from a chain store.

Dealers are able to offer more advanced keys, such those with a chip, however, you'll have to visit the dealer. Some dealers offer discounts on chipped keys. To qualify for a discount you need to know the year, the make model, year, and model of the car.

Another type of key that's hard to duplicate is a "Do Not Duplicate" key. This inscription is placed by the companies that make the keys, and it basically states that duplicates of the key is not legal. This is why certain locksmiths will not duplicate the keys.

There are a variety of keys. The most common are either blank or engraved. Decorative keys are available in fun shapes and colors, and can be painted or etched to cost more.
